28 APRIL 2016 -- ST. LOUIS -- Hannah Ziobrowski, a student at Washington University in St. Louis George Warren Brown School of Social Work, discusses her project "What is the Role of Binge Eating Disorder in the Association Between Depression and Obesity in US Adult Women" during "Research without Walls," the school's annual student research symposium, Thursday, April 28, 2016 at Hillman Hall on the Danforth Campus in St. Louis. Masters and doctoral students presented summaries of their research on posters, with the top presentations receiving recognition. Carroll Rodriguez, Senior VP Public Policy and Communications for the Alzheimer's Association, St. Louis Chapter, delivered the keynote address.
